Characters of Leaf Epidermis of Begonia (Begoniaceae) from China and Their Taxonomic Significance

Abstract

Leaf epidermis of 52 species and two varieties representing seven sections of Begonia(Begoniaceae) from China were examined under light microscopy.The results showed that leaf epidermal characters of the genus revealed a remarkable consistency:the leaf epidermal cells were usually polygonal and subpolygonal bearing with straight or arched anticlinal walls;and the stomatal apparatus was mainly anisocytic type and presented in abaxial epidermis of all studied species.However,the multiple leaf epidermal characters,including the shape of epidermal cells,the pattern of epidermal hairs,the shape of stomatal apparatus,the type of crystals in epidermal cells and some distinct characters varies obviously with species,in particular among species allies.
